Text Annotation:
StructureLevelPatternNotes
future midbrain floor plate
detected detected
Expressed in mesencephalic floor.
tail paraxial mesenchyme
detected detected
Expressed in the segmental plate
future midbrain roof plate
detected detected
Expressed in mesencephalic roof.
future hindbrain
detected detected
regionalExpressed in the sulcus limitans and medulla oblongata.
diencephalon
detected detected
regionalExpressed in hypothalamus.

Notes:The Pcdh8 probe template used in this study by Makarenkova et al., 2005 [PMID:15627506] was "generated by genomic PCR. To detect both Pcdh8 isoforms (as used in this assay), a 1053-bp genomic fragment from the first coding exon was amplified (nucleotides 151-1203 from the initiation codon) using the following PCR primers: forward primer, 5' GAAGACCTGCACATGAAAGTGTTTGGAGAC 3'; reverse primer, 5' CAGCGAGGTGATACCGGCTTCATGTGTC 3'. This fragment was initially cloned into a TOPO vector (InVitrogen, Carlsbad, CA). It was then recloned as a HindIII-EcoRI fragment into pLITMUS 28 (New England Biolabs, Beverly, MA), and used as a template to generate a riboprobe by in vitro transcription using T7 polymerase".
